Table 1.

Summary of the GCs analysed in this work.

Object RA0 Dec0 rJ N* σrv Afit Apeak − peak PA0 Afit/σrv
[deg] [deg] [deg] [km s−1] [km s−1] [km s−1] [deg]
NGC 0104 47 Tuc 6.02379 –72.08131 1.557 302 12.0 9.16 ± 0.50 12.41 ± 0.39 216 0.76
NGC 0362 15.80942 –70.84878 0.598 70 8.6 3.57 ± 0.08 3.63 ± 0.88 234 0.42
NGC 1851 78.52816 –40.04655 0.611 71 11.0 5.59 ± 0.13 5.94 ± 5.84 180 0.51
NGC 2808 138.01291 –64.86349 0.944 132 14.1 8.42 ± 0.34 8.29 ± 1.00 198 0.60
NGC 3201 154.40343 –46.41248 0.925 217 4.7 3.37 ± 0.10 3.88 ± 0.26 324 0.72
NGC 5139 ω Cen 201.69699 –47.47947 2.142 1864 17.7 13.85 ± 0.25 12.98 ± 0.29 162 0.78
NGC 5272 M 3 205.54842 28.37728 0.714 299 7.8 2.46 ± 0.12 2.85 ± 0.40 162 0.32
NGC 5904 M 5 229.63841 2.08103 0.607 259 7.8 8.03 ± 0.14 7.88 ± 0.74 198 1.03
NGC 6121 M 4 245.86974 –26.52575 1.658 224 4.8 2.70 ± 0.08 3.16 ± 0.15 234 0.56
NGC 6171 248.13275 –13.05378 0.368 65 4.1 0.77 ± 0.09 1.38 ± 0.34 234 0.19
NGC 6205 250.42181 36.45986 1.036 152 9.6 5.62 ± 0.17 6.03 ± 0.72 306 0.59
NGC 6254 M 10 254.28772 –4.10031 0.611 87 6.3 2.27 ± 0.16 3.74 ± 0.46 198 0.36
NGC 6273 255.65749 –26.26797 0.266 81 12.1 2.37 ± 0.22 3.78 ± 2.32 270 0.20
NGC 6341 259.28076 43.13594 0.808 80 8.7 4.18 ± 0.11 5.31 ± 0.91 216 0.48
NGC 6388 264.07178 –44.7355 0.516 75 17.4 6.64 ± 0.47 11.68 ± 2.58 270 0.38
NGC 6397 265.17538 –53.67434 1.174 187 5.5 1.39 ± 0.08 1.93 ± 0.64 198 0.25
NGC 6656 M 22 279.09976 –23.90475 1.308 412 8.9 5.75 ± 0.06 6.24 ± 0.98 252 0.65
NGC 6715 M 54 283.76385 –30.47986 0.618 1809 19.2 6.01 ± 0.18 8.20 ± 0.57 252 0.31
NGC 6752 287.7171 –59.98455 0.913 152 7.7 1.04 ± 0.15 1.19 ± 0.34 162 0.14
NGC 6809 294.99878 –30.96475 0.549 98 4.9 3.58 ± 0.10 3.35 ± 0.28 252 0.73
NGC 7078 M 15 322.49304 12.167 0.757 155 13.0 4.16 ± 0.10 4.83 ± 1.45 234 0.32

NGC 6218 251.80907 –1.94853 0.508 107 4.8
NGC 6838 298.44373 18.77919 0.619 129 2.7

Notes. The target names and their coordinates of the GC center from the Vasiliev & Baumgardt (2021) catalog are listed in Cols. 1–4. The Jacobi radius for each cluster is listed in the fifth column. The number of stars available for the various clusters is shown in the sixth column, while the seventh column contains the adopted radial velocity dispersion. The eighth and ninth columns show the rotation amplitude values calculated using the best-fit sine function method and the peak-to-peak method respectively. The tenth column shows the values of the PA of the rotation axis, following the methodology used to calculate Afit. These values were converted and reported into PA 90 = east, anti-clockwise system. Finally, in the last column, the values of V/σ (or Afit/σrv) calculated for each cluster. The last two GCs are clusters that do not show signature of systemic rotation.
